Niagara Regional Police have arrested a St. Catharines man following a reported sexual assault.
On Monday, October 6, a woman told police she was standing at Geneva Street and Welland Avenue around 1:30 p.m. when a man walked past her, circled back, and slapped her on the buttocks.
The victim provided a photo of the suspect, which helped officers locate him nearby.
As a result, 22-year-old Brady Burke of St. Catharines was arrested and charged with sexual assault and failing to comply with a probation order.
